**Ticket: FLAGR-surge rollout blocked — signature check failing**

Hey folks, quick heads up for anyone new: the Surgeboard flag-rollout bundle is failing verification on the Pebbletown staging cluster. Looks like the verifier is still pinned to the old key after Tuesday's rotation. Easy fix — update your local config to trust the new release key, pasted below for convenience.

deploy key for yajop-fahop: bky3_h1v

Subject: Key rotation — Gratitudo receipt mailer

Hey — quick heads up before you review my PR. I rotated the Gratitudo donation-receipt mailer key after the staging leak scare last week. Old key dies Friday; the new one is already live in the deploy config. For your local smoke test, the replacement key is below.

service key, fawip-bajef: kto11_Qt5wZK9vdNC

Subject: DR Drill — InvoicePress Renderer

Team,

This Thursday we'll run the quarterly disaster-recovery drill for the InvoicePress PDF renderer at Quillhaven Billing. On-call should restore the render farm from the cold snapshot and confirm sample invoices match checksums. To unseal the snapshot archive during the drill, enter the recovery passphrase below.

vault phrase of kawef-yahop = wenir-jorox-druys-belion-kelion-lamvan-frawyn-norael-julox-raleth-rusax-oliys-holael

Subject: DR drill Thursday — user module split. Hi — quick heads-up for this week's disaster-recovery drill on Cardelia. We're failing over the newly split user module to the standby region while the rest of the monolith stays put, so expect session churn for about twenty minutes. Your part: confirm the release freeze, then restore admin access on the standby console once traffic shifts. The console's recovery prompt will ask for the passphrase below.

vault phrase of tajef-tafog = istox-sorax-zorox-casok-holox-kelix-weneth-drueth-casion